# fetchit
|
||||
Works on my machine
|
||||
|
||||
`fetchit` is a Linux terminal system information viewer written in C++. It's a single-file program (`main.cpp`) that prints a colored distro logo (when available) alongside system and hardware info, similar to neofetch/fastfetch.
|
||||
|
||||
## Features
|
||||
|
||||
- Shows: distro, kernel, uptime, shell, CPU, GPU, RAM, and "OS Date".
|
||||
- Distro detection via `/etc/os-release` (`PRETTY_NAME` for display, `ID` for logo matching).
|
||||
- Colored ASCII distro logos for supported distros.
|
||||
- GPU detection by scanning PCI devices (`/sys/bus/pci/devices/`) for class `0x03*`.
|
||||
- GPU name resolution via `/usr/share/hwdata/pci.ids` (falls back to hex IDs if missing).
|
||||
- Accounts for Unicode character width for better alignment in terminals.
|
||||
|
||||
## Supported Distro Logos
|
||||
|
||||
Logos are matched against `/etc/os-release` `ID`:
|
||||
|
||||
`arch`, `cachyos`, `debian`, `ubuntu`, `fedora`, `manjaro`, `opensuse`, `pop`, `linuxmint`, `endeavouros`, `void`, `alpine`
|
||||
|
||||
## Requirements
|
||||
|
||||
- Linux
|
||||
- A C++17-capable compiler (default: `g++`)
|
||||
- UTF-8 locale + ANSI color support (recommended for icons/colors)
|
||||
- Reads the following files/paths:
|
||||
- `/etc/os-release`
|
||||
- `/etc/hostname`
|
||||
- `/proc/uptime`
|
||||
- `/proc/cpuinfo`
|
||||
- `/proc/meminfo`
|
||||
- `/sys/bus/pci/devices/`
|
||||
- `/sys/devices/system/cpu/cpu0/cpufreq/cpuinfo_max_freq`
|
||||
- `/usr/share/hwdata/pci.ids` (optional)
|
||||

## Notes
|
||||
|
||||
- `shell` is taken from `$SHELL` and printed as the basename (e.g. `bash`, not `/usr/bin/bash`).
|
||||
- `OS Date` is computed from `/etc/hostname` file metadata (`ctime`) as an elapsed duration; it may not equal the OS install date.
|
||||
- If `pci.ids` is unavailable, GPU(s) are printed as hex IDs like `0xVVVV:0xDDDD`.
|
||||
- If no distro logo matches, the logo section will be empty and only info lines are shown.
|
